Transaction 311a07b625f338367948af5481b96e76365724e169e16028e4dd75a5077c1a91

1 Input
2 Outputs
  • 311a07b625f338367948af5481b96e76365724e169e16028e4dd75a5077c1a91:0
  • value  153783834
    address  3PPz5iv9bcN1ov3azCw14ozfpirJDW4g9V
  • 311a07b625f338367948af5481b96e76365724e169e16028e4dd75a5077c1a91:1
  • value  772585
    address  3JcG7Sc4vaNfRAgXFoo3p1ZF9Vo5b4qMfw